Obamacare Enrolment Extension Sought To Avoid Tax Penalty

Following the end of the Affordable Care Act's (ACA's) open enrollment period for 2015 on February 15, Democrat lawmakers have urged the US Administration to grant a special enrollment period for individuals paying a shared responsibility payment – or tax penalty – for 2014.  The ACA's provisions give tax incentives to individuals to offset health care expenses, but they also impose penalties, administered through the tax code on their tax returns each year, on individuals who do not obtain "minimum essential" health care coverage for themselves or their families.
